The Junior Board is pleased to announce that our Bollywood Bash to support the Armaan Club was a success! The event was completely sold out and we brought in $2,445! We are so happy with the amount of people that came out to support and have fun!
We started off the night with food donated from local vendors, drinks, and music by DJ Jon Garcia. The mingling transitioned into Bollywood dance instruction by Gopi Engineer of the Meher Dance Company. Hardly anybody was too shy to dance and Gopi brought so much energy and enthusiasm that everyone couldn’t help but enjoy themselves even if they were just watching.
Not only was there dancing, there was a silent auction with many great sponsors such as Lucky Strike, Art Institute of Chicago, and Nadeau: Furniture with a Soul to name just a few. We were also lucky to have Bala Thiagarajan give many guests henna tattoos and display her beautiful paintings. The night was successful beyond our expectations.
